#052c4c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#052c4c is composed of 2% red, 17.3%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 15.9%. #052c4c color hex could be obtained by blending #0a5898 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#052c4c color description : Very dark blue.

#052c4c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#052c4c has RGB values of R:5, G:44,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 339020.

Shades and Tints of #052c4c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#052c4c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#27292a is the less saturated color, while #022c4f is the most saturated one.
